Job Family: Software Req ID: 509606 Join Siemens Digital Industries Software as a Finance Program Manager and play a pivotal role in the SAP transformation of our company. You will head the Accounting (Record-to-Report) workstream of our SAP S/4Hana implementation and lead other complex, multi-disciplinary projects from start to finish. Responsibilities Oversee tactical planning and day-to-day management of the Record-to-Report workstream, which comprises functionality for areas such as Fixed Assets, Accounts Payables, Cash & Banks, Revenue Recognition, and General Ledger.
Work with our cross-functional partners to plan requirements, manage project schedules, and drive collaboration to ensure timely completion of the development work. Monitor program performance, identify risks and issues, and implement appropriate mitigation strategies. Coordinate various testing activities, manage our data migration & validation, and supervise deployment & cut-over activities.
Manage and co-lead other IT projects in our legacy SAP environment. Provide leadership and guidance to project teams, fostering a collaborative and high-performance work environment. Qualifications 10+ years of total experience in Accounting and ERP projects (SAP preferred) Demonstrate excellent project management skills (3+ yrs) with a proven track record of managing timelines and resources efficiently.
Have multiple years' experience in ERP transformation projects (SAP) with a large consulting firm or as an internal consultant. Possess exceptional problem-solving skills and the ability to make decisions in high-pressure situations. Showcase excellent communication and presentation skills with a strong executive presence.
Be excited to collaborate with our finance and business teams in the office for 2-3 days per week.
